Oracle是一种常用的关系型数据库管理系统,它提供了许多强大的函数和技巧来操作数据。本文将重点介绍如何使用Oracle中的取小函数。
取小函数可以帮助我们在一个有序的数据集中,快速选出最小值,这对于数据分析和处理来说非常重要。在Oracle中,取小函数可以使用MIN函数来实现。
SELECT MIN(column) FROM table;
上述代码将会返回table表中column列中的最小值。例如,我们有以下一个表格:
ID | Name | Age
-------------------
1 | Alice | 28
2 | Bob | 25
3 | Charlie| 32
4 | David | 21
如果我们要找到这个表格中最小的年龄,我们可以使用以下代码:
SELECT MIN(Age) FROM table;
这将会返回21,也就是David的年龄。
当我们需要查找某些特定数据的最小值时,我们可以使用WHERE子句来筛选数据。例如,如果我们想要找到这个表格中所有17岁以下的人中最小的年龄,我们可以使用以下代码:
SELECT MIN(Age) FROM table WHERE Age
如果没有符合条件的数据,则该代码将会返回NULL。
除了基本的取小函数,我们还可以使用一些高级函数来处理数据。例如,如果我们希望在表格中查找所有最小年龄的数据,我们可以使用以下代码:
SELECT * FROM table WHERE Age = (SELECT MIN(Age) FROM table);
这会返回表格中所有年龄最小的数据,例如:
ID | Name | Age
-------------------
4 | David | 21
通过这些简单的方法,我们可以在Oracle中轻松地寻找最小值,以进行有效的数据处理和分析。